A calendar spread sells a near-dated option and buys a longer-dated one at the same strike, paying a net debit. It profits when the near option decays faster than the far one loses value, which makes it a trade on the volatility term structure: richest when near-dated volatility is expensive relative to far-dated.
Differential decay. The short near-dated leg bleeds time value at the steep end of the decay curve while the long far-dated leg sits on the shallow end, and the position collects the difference as long as the stock stays near the strike. Its risks are the mirror image: a large move in either direction hurts (both legs go far from the money and the differential vanishes), and a collapse in far-dated implied volatility hurts the long leg specifically. Maximum loss is the debit paid, which keeps the structure in the defined-risk family.
An earnings announcement inflates the expiration that spans it far more than later expirations: the event's uncertainty lives almost entirely in the front expiry. Selling that inflated front expiration and buying a calmer later one, at the money, harvests the collapse of event premium (the IV crush) the morning after the print while the long leg barely moves. The screen that keeps this honest checks that the event premium is genuinely rich first, comparing the implied announcement move against the stock's own history of realized earnings moves, and passes only when the market is paying above that history. Double calendars, one call calendar above and one put calendar below, widen the profitable band for stocks that drift on the print.
In steep contango away from any event: when far-dated volatility prices well above near-dated as a resting state, the calendar's long leg is the expensive one, and the structure fights its own entry price. The favorable configuration is the opposite, near-dated volatility elevated relative to far, whether from an event, a news cycle, or short-term stress, because then the spread sells the expensive end. Reading the curve before choosing the structure is the whole game; the same curve that sizes index positions also picks between condors and calendars.
